Differential expression of RhoA gene in SMART-Cas9 knockout macrophages


ABSTRACT: We have identified that Ras homolog gene family member A (RhoA) is a pivotal target in inducing osteoclastogenesis in macrophages. Subsequently, we developed a strategy termed Specific Macrophage RhoA Targeting (SMART). In this strategy, phosphatidylserine-enriched macrophage membranes are engineered to deliver CRISPR-Cas9 plasmids containing a macrophage-specific promoter (SMART-Cas9), thereby enabling targeted editing of the RhoA gene in RAW264.7 macrophages. High-throughput transcriptome sequencing was then performed. Transcriptome analysis revealed that ablation of the macrophage RhoA gene significantly inhibited key signaling pathways associated with bone destruction.

ORGANISM(S): Mus musculus
